Description

Missing Authorization vulnerability in Claspo Popup Builders Claspo – Popups, Spin the Wheel & Email Capture claspo allows Exploiting Incorrectly Configured Access Control Security Levels.This issue affects Claspo – Popups, Spin the Wheel & Email Capture: from n/a through <= 1.0.7.

CWE ID Description
CWE-862 The product does not perform an authorization check when an actor attempts to access a resource or perform an action.

Executive Summary

This vulnerability is a Missing Authorization issue in the Popup Builder plugin by integrationclaspo. It affects features like Exit-Intent pop-up, Spin the Wheel, Newsletter signup, Email Capture, and Lead Generation forms. The problem arises from incorrectly configured access control security levels, which means unauthorized users might exploit the plugin due to insufficient authorization checks.

Impact Analysis

The impact of this vulnerability could include unauthorized access or manipulation of popup and lead generation features, potentially allowing attackers to bypass security controls and exploit the plugin's functionalities for malicious purposes.
